Corporate Stays vs Standard Airbnb Guests – Why Quality Matters

In today’s competitive short-term rental market, property owners are increasingly faced with a critical decision: to cater primarily to standard Airbnb guests or to pivot towards corporate stays. While both options present unique advantages, understanding the nuances between them is essential for landlords seeking the most lucrative path. This blog delves into why quality is paramount when comparing corporate stays with standard Airbnb guests, including occupancy rates, the nature of bookings, and the benefits of focusing on a more professional clientele.

H2: Understanding Corporate Stays

Corporate stays refer to accommodations specifically arranged for business travellers such as contractors, employees on temporary assignments, or individuals in need of housing during insurance relocations. Unlike traditional holiday guests, who typically seek short, leisure-based stays, corporate clients often require longer-term housing solutions—averaging stays of 30 to 90+ nights. This significant difference in stay duration equates to reduced turnover and enhanced stability for landlords.

H3: Key Features of Corporate Stays

– **Stable Income**: Corporate tenants tend to commit to longer leases, which contribute to steadier cash flow.
– **Less Wear and Tear**: Professional guests are likely to maintain the property better than typical weekend visitors, reducing the costs associated with maintenance and repairs.

H2: The Standard Airbnb Guest Landscape

Standard Airbnb guests are typically families or individuals seeking short-term holiday rentals for leisure or events. While this demographic can yield a high occupancy rate during peak seasons, it often comes with greater variability in booking frequency and guest quality.

H3: Key Characteristics of Standard Airbnb Guests

– **Shorter Stays**: Typical booking periods range from just a few nights to a week, resulting in frequent tenant turnover.
– **Higher Maintenance Costs**: Increased wear and tear due to high-student or group bookings may require regular upkeep on the property.
– **Unpredictable Income**: Revenue can fluctuate considerably, particularly during off-peak seasons, making it challenging to budget effectively.

H2: Why Quality Beats Quantity

When discussing corporate stays versus standard Airbnb guests, the phrase "quality over quantity" can be particularly relevant. Here are a few reasons why prioritising high-quality, professional tenants can be a game-changer for landlords:

– **Consistent Earnings**: By focusing on corporate stays, property owners can secure a more dependable income stream. Long-term bookings mean less time and effort on marketing the property for new tenants.

– **Reduced Marketing Costs**: Without the need for frequent marketing to attract new guests, landlords can save on advertising expenses. – **Enhanced Property Care**: Corporate guests are generally more responsible, reducing the likelihood of damages or disruptive behaviour, which can be a significant concern with standard Airbnb guests.

H2: Managing Corporate Stays

For property owners considering a focus on corporate stays, efficient management practices are essential. Effective communication, professional standards, and ensuring a seamless booking experience can set landlords apart from competitors.

H3: Key Management Strategies

– **Direct Invoicing Options**: Streamlining the invoicing process for your corporate clients can make the rental experience more appealing. Many corporations prefer or require direct invoicing, so accommodating this can help secure those lucrative bookings.

– **Tailored Amenities**: Offering amenities that appeal to corporate guests—such as high-speed Wi-Fi, spacious workspaces, and easy access to public transportation—can create a competitive edge.

– **Collaboration with Corporations**: Building relationships directly with companies in need of contractor accommodation or temporary housing can lead to a steady influx of bookings and less reliance on OTAs.

H2: Conclusion

Shifting focus from standard Airbnb guests to corporate stays can provide landlords with lucrative benefits, including increased income stability, reduced maintenance costs, and better overall tenant quality. The corporate accommodation sector is growing, and by leveraging existing relationships and distribution channels, landlords can make the most of long-term, workforce-based rentals.
